kvm: Allow build-time configuration of KVM device assignment
We hope to at some point deprecate KVM legacy device assignment in
favor of VFIO-based assignment.  Towards that end, allow legacy
device assignment to be deconfigured.

+config KVM_DEVICE_ASSIGNMENT
+	bool "KVM legacy PCI device assignment support"
+	depends on KVM && PCI && IOMMU_API
+	default y
+	---help---
+	  Provide support for legacy PCI device assignment through KVM.  The
+	  kernel now also supports a full featured userspace device driver
+	  framework through VFIO, which supersedes much of this support.
+
+	  If unsure, say Y.
